Antigua and Barbuda Passport Ranks 49th Globally

Antigua and Barbuda’s passport has been ranked 49th in the world, with a mobility score of 143, according to the latest global passport rankings. The ranking reflects the number of destinations that Antiguan and Barbudan passport holders can access without requiring a visa in advance, highlighting the strength of the country’s travel document. Government Eyes Near EC$100M Jolly Beach Sale

The Government of Antigua and Barbuda says several potential buyers have expressed interest in acquiring the Jolly Beach property as efforts continue to finalize a sale.
